1917 – 2003

BRUNSWICK – Margaret L. Tyler, 86, died Wednesday, April 30, after a long illness.

She was born in Auburn, March 31, 1917, the daughter of Otis and Margaret (McCarthy) Parker. She moved to Lewiston as a small child.

She graduated from C.M.G. Hospital Nursing School and studied pediatrics at Cook County Hospital in Chicago. She married Herbert M. Tyler in Lewiston July 6, 1946. Mr. Tyler died Feb. 12, 1993.

Mrs. Tyler was a supervisor of nursing at Children’s Hospital in Portland from 1940 until it closed. After raising a family, she returned to nursing at Portland City Hospital. She moved to Topsham in 1988.

She is survived by her four children, Kelly Tyler of Topsham, Patricia Fullam of Manchester, NH, Carol Sheloske of Topsham and John Tyler of Brunswick; a brother, Bernard Parker and his wife, Dorothy of Auburn; nine grandchildren; and four great-grandchildren.
